Happy Earth Day, CNMI!

Today marks the 51st celebration of Earth Day, an international event celebrated by a billion people from over 190 countries all over the world, to provide a voice for the Earth, to raise awareness, and highlight environmental concerns impacting everyone on the planet. Here in...

No live audience at Saipan Wind Band Festival this Sunday

The 4th Annual Saipan Wind Band Festival, hosted by Mount Carmel School and sponsored by the Public School System, is happening this Sunday, April 25, but with no live audience due to COVID-19 restrictions. Instead, the festival, which will take place from 3:30pm to 6:30pm at...
